Biography

Headshot of Benjamin Riggan

Benjamin S. Riggan is an Associate Professor in the Department of Electrical Engineering and Computer Science at the University of Tennessee, Knoxville. Prior to joining UT Knoxville, he was an Associate Professor in the Department of Electrical and Computer Engineering at the University of Nebraska–Lincoln. He previously served as a Research Scientist and Postdoctoral Fellow with the U.S. Army Research Laboratory, where he conducted research in artificial intelligence, computer vision, image and signal processing, and advanced sensing technologies.

Riggan’s research focuses on domain adaptive artificial intelligence, with an emphasis on principled advancements at the intersection of artificial intelligence, machine learning, and optical physics. His group develops robust and adaptive AI systems that advance computer vision, image and signal processing, and biometrics for complex and changing environments. These efforts support impactful applications spanning national security and public safety, including defense, intelligence, law enforcement, privacy, and precision agriculture.

At the University of Tennessee, Riggan continues to advance fundamental research in intelligent sensing and perception while contributing to workforce development through education and mentorship of the next generation of engineers and scientists.
